Transaction d2abb665e6a006b94cb4484fffc2abb8ea21903571bf58597af243816e024aa5
1 Input
1 Output
-
d2abb665e6a006b94cb4484fffc2abb8ea21903571bf58597af243816e024aa5:0
- value
- 323550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20ab2a1f26396101361ee79bb5ae137bd95e1ec9 OP_EQUAL
- address
- 34fkbQKdew9xrBiZhwhmGYnKFon6wrcPa4